Bechtel Energy secures EPC contract for Port Arthur LNG Phase 2
Sempra Infrastructure has awarded Bechtel Energy with a fixed-price engineering, procurement, and construction (EPC) contract for the second phase of Texas-based Port Arthur LNG.
